WebApr 19, 2024 · The best time to check the engine oil level is after the engine is at operating temperature. Allow the engine to be shut off for at least 5 minutes before checking the oil level. Checking the oil level while the vehicle is on level ground will improve the accuracy of the oil level reading. some additional info: WebFollow these steps to check your engine oil level: Remove the dipstick, pulling it out of the tube. Wipe the dipstick clean using a paper towel or rag. Reinsert the dipstick, ensuring it is fully seated. Remove the dipstick again, and check the oil level, which should fall between the minimum and maximum marks.
